Full stoppage of TGV, Thalys and Eurostar travel between France and Belgium

All high-speed traffic on the line between France and Belgium has been interrupted in both directions since shortly before 11 a.m. due to a driver of a TGV coming from France reporting that it touched a catenary cable. The cable supplies current to trains and was hanging, causing the train to come to a standstill. … Read more

Two people severely injured after a serious truck collision causing major traffic congestion on the E314.

According to Mayor Alain Yzermans’ (Vooruit) Facebook page, there has been a serious traffic accident on the E314 slip road in Houthalen involving several trucks and cars that has resulted in one or more possible injuries. Experts are currently at the scene. Two trucks and a van were involved, and firefighters from the East Limburg … Read more
